Membership card, W. H. M. Bellows, Gymnasium, Boston Young Men's Christian Union, 18 Boylston Street, September 15, 1876

Membership card for the gymnasium of the Boston Young Men's Christian Union, located at 18 Boylston Street. Belonging to W. H. M. Bellows, the card is valid for three months, beginning October 29th, 1877.

Trade card for A. H. Howe & Sons, 170 Tremont Street, Boston, Mass., 1908 October 12

Trade card advertising A. H. Howe & Sons, a shoemaker based at 170 Tremont Street, Boston, Massachusetts. The trade card advertises "bench made 'Walk-Over shoes.'" The trade card is dated October 12, 1908. The verso of the trade card is a postcard addressed to Mr. Porter at the Back Bay Hotel.

Studio portrait of Alice Blight, undated

Studio portrait of Alice Blight taken at The Notman Photographic Co. in Boston, Massachusetts. Alice is depicted wearing a dress with lace detail, a lace bonnet, and boot. She is pictured with two dogs, one on either side. The cabinet card is undated.

Diaries of machinist Nathaniel S. Raymond, Lynn, Massachusetts, 1855, 1859

Two string bound diaries belonging to machinist Nathaniel S. Raymond based in Lynn, Massachusetts. The diaries contain detailed descriptions of skilled labor and ongoing business transactions. The majority of each diary documents the daily labor, travel, expenses, and business negotiations undertake...

Exterior view of the house of William Appleton Thomas, Kingston, Mass., undated

Albumen print depicting exterior view of William Appleton Thomas's house in Kingston, Rhode Island. Two unidentified women and an unidentified child are pictured on the porch of the house. Two unidentified men are pictured standing near the house with a horse and open carriage.
